loadqcqp
Such a problem may have quadratic terms in its objective function as well as in its constraints.
loadqcqp(
prob,
probname,
rowtype,
rhs,
rng,
objcoef,
start,
collen,
rowind,
rowcoef,
lb,
ub,
objqcol1,
objqcol2,
objqcoef,
qrowind,
nrowqcoef,
rowqcol1,
rowqcol2,
rowqcoef,
ncols = x_max_vec_length(objcoef, lb, ub),
nrows = x_max_vec_length(rowtype, rhs, rng),
nobjqcoefs = x_max_vec_length(objqcol1, objqcol2, objqcoef),
nqrows = x_max_vec_length(qrowind, nrowqcoef)
)
prob
|
The current problem.
|
probname
|
A string of up to MAXPROBNAMELENGTH characters containing a name for the problem.
|
rowtype
|
Character array of length
nrows containing the row types:
|
rhs
|
Double array of length
nrows containing the right hand side coefficients of the rows.
|
rng
|
Double array of length
nrows containing the range values for range rows.
|
objcoef
|
Double array of length
ncols containing the objective function coefficients.
|
start
|
Integer array containing the offsets in the
rowind and
rowcoef arrays of the start of the elements for each column.
|
collen
|
Integer array of length
ncols containing the number of nonzero elements in each column.
|
rowind
|
Integer array containing the row indices for the nonzero elements in each column.
|
rowcoef
|
Double array containing the nonzero element values; length as for
rowind.
|
lb
|
Double array of length
ncols containing the lower bounds on the columns.
|
ub
|
Double array of length
ncols containing the upper bounds on the columns.
|
objqcol1
|
Integer array of size
nobjqcoefs containing the column index of the first variable in each quadratic term.
|
objqcol2
|
Integer array of size
nobjqcoefs containing the column index of the second variable in each quadratic term.
|
objqcoef
|
Double array of size
nobjqcoefs containing the quadratic coefficients.
|
qrowind
|
Integer array of size
nqrows, containing the indices of rows with quadratic matrices in them.
|
nrowqcoef
|
Integer array of size
nqrows, containing the number of nonzeros in each quadratic constraint matrix.
|
rowqcol1
|
Integer array of size
nqcelem, where
nqcelem equals the sum of the elements in
nrowqcoef (i.e. the total number of quadratic matrix elements in all the constraints).
|
rowqcol2
|
Integer array of size
nqcelem, containing the second index for the quadratic constraint matrices.
|
rowqcoef
|
Integer array of size
nqcelem, containing the coefficients for the quadratic constraint matrices.
|
ncols
|
Number of structural columns in the matrix.
|
nrows
|
Number of rows in the matrix (not including the objective row).
|
nobjqcoefs
|
Number of quadratic terms.
|
nqrows
|
Number of rows containing quadratic matrices.
